Output 106c773ba03aac35dc144452e25f243964be4c50df7744e76072d54db4eed52d:3

value
324301728849
script pubkey
OP_0 OP_PUSHBYTES_20 95a31bbebcbcdcc1b51b4084c56e9e48a5c1a89a
address
ltc1qjk33h04uhnwvrdgmgzzv2m57fzjur2y6066s0n
transaction
106c773ba03aac35dc144452e25f243964be4c50df7744e76072d54db4eed52d
spent
true